Purpose of the role : To provide a professional social work perspective as a member of the multidisciplinary team. To identify and assess the psycho-social needs of clients, their families / whanau and significant others. To provide recovery focused social work interventions as per the DMHS Social Work Scope of Practice. To act as Care Coordinator for an identified number of clients To provide generic mental health assessment as part of a multi-disciplinary team KEY TASKS 1. To practice as a social worker, providing specialist social work interventions within a WDHB CAHMS Team. 2. To work as an effective team member. EXPECTED OUTCOMES. Provide focused social work assessment and interventions with clients as per the DMHS Social Work Scope of Practice (Community Social Work Role). Social work issues for clients are highlighted to the clinical team. Social work interventions and outcomes will be recorded in clinical files, and communicated to the clinical team. Understand and work within Team Standard Operating Procedures. Observe and identify roles, functions and philosophies of the multi disciplinary team. Share clinical responsibility with the multidisciplinary team. Actively participate in the multidisciplinary team, to achieve integrated outcomes for clients. Participate in regular policy, quality and clinical meetings. Attend planning days. Demonstrate adherence to the National Mental Health Sector Standards. Client rights and responsibilities are actively supported. Ensures that all administrative and clinical data entry is completed in a timely manner 3. Work in partnership with clients, whanau / families and significant others. Demonstrate understanding of the MoH Involving Families Guidelines 2000. Supports involvement of and communication between the clinical team and family / whanau regarding client s progress and care plans. Identify and assess the psychosocial needs of family / whanau / significant others. Establish liaison and advocacy role to support client s in their personal relationships. Provide necessary information to assist others in meeting the client s needs. 4. Establish and maintain community networks. Identify and attend local community mental health networking groups. Maintain regular contact / consultancy with NGO s. Maintain updated information on community resources, accessible to the multidisciplinary team. Support students with agency placements. 5. Demonstrate a commitment to personal and professional development. Complete orientation and mandatory training. Participate in WDHB Performance Development Review process. Undertake regular team member and professional supervision as agreed with Team Manager and Locality Senior Social Worker. Waitemata District Health Board -JOB DESCRIPTION - Page 3

Proactively maintain a professional knowledge base. Undertake project work as agreed with Team Manager and SMO Attend WDHB Social Work forum and other agreed and relevant forums related to community mental health care/services. Take responsibility for role modeling and supporting the DMHS Social Work Scope of Practice. 6. Recognise the principles of the Treaty of Waitangi while acknowledging cultural and social differences of all groups. WDHB s commitment to biculturalism is honoured. Collaboratively seeks culturally appropriate input into clinical practice. 7. Recognise individual responsibility for workplace health and safety under the Health & Safety Act, 1992. PERSON SPECIFICATION POSITION TITLE: Social Worker, Community Mental Health Team Qualification Experience Skills/Knowledge/ Behaviour Minimum All Social Work Positions Qualification in Social Work Full Drivers License Experience of working in a mental health / social work setting. Ability to respect other peoples values and culture. Commitment to empowerment of clients, their families and whanau and significant others. A high level of oral and written communication skills. Commitment to the highest standards of social work practice. Good time management skills Preferred Degree in Social Work or equivalent Full Membership of ANZASW Professional Registration Previous employment within a mental health service agency. Experience and knowledge of working with Maori and Pacific Island clients. Experience with a child mental health team preferable Significant experience of provision of community based services.
